psychosynthesis
(psy¦cho|syn¦the¦sis)
Pronunciation:
/ˌsʌɪkəʊˈsɪnθɪsɪs/
noun
[
mass noun
]
Psychoanalysis
the integration of separated elements of the psyche or personality.
